Costello Music, their first album released in 2006, is a little gem plenty of classic rock rythmthes, bring you back to the 60's. Hackney's Oslo presents Live: Oslo Sessions this month – May 26. This session sees Hunck, Sego, Bleeding Heartpigeons and Warhaus take the stage to display the best new music, as selected by the fine tastemakers at Oslo, currently emerging across the world. This month's live sessions takes hazy, guitar music as its theme, with Sego representing Utah-grown slacker-punk for long, summer days and Bleeding Heart Pigeons bringing hazy electronics and jazzy indie.
